Luxury Experiential Resort Lumeria Maui Opens in Maui
Surfer-centric town Paia, on Maui’s North Shore, welcomed a new luxury resort to its midst in early March. Located on six acres of former sugarcane land, not far from famous surf spot Ho’okipa Beach, Lumeria Maui is an experiential retreat with programs and classes centered on yoga, surfing, meditation, and Hawaiian culture.

Hoping to Hang Ten on Costa Rica? Known where to find the different types of breaks
Beach breaks are the best type for beginners. Waves break over sandbars and the seafloor. Jacó, Hermosa, and Sámara are all beach breaks. Point breaks are created as waves hit a point jutting into the ocean.

Into surfing—or just watching? Know where to find Oahu's biggest waves.
The waves switch with the seasons—they're big in the south in summer, and they loom large in the north in winter. If you're not experienced, it's best to go where the waves are small. There will be fewer crowds, and your chances of injury dramatically decrease.

Leeward or Windward? Know which side of the island you want in the Caribbean.
Decide whether you want a hotel on the leeward side of an island (with calm water, good for snorkeling and swimming) or the windward (with waves, good for surfing, not good for swimming).
